Adel El Hallak and Kris Murphy from NVIDIA will share how teams can secure long-running AI agents from setup to sandboxing, with a focus on permissions, execution boundaries, and controls for agentic enterprise systems.
Key Takeaways:
Long-running agents require identity, access, sandboxing, and policy controls before production deployment
Tool use and memory increase security requirements across data, applications, and infrastructure
Operational guardrails help teams audit, contain, and safely scale agentic workflows
